Eurostat: Czech enterprises' presence in social networks, blogs, multimedia content-sharing below EU average

According to the recently published Eurostat data on enterprises' presence on the internet, 83% of Czech businesses have a website, compared with the EU-28 average of 75%. The use of social media by Czech enterprises is below the EU average, though.

Experts at Czech Technical University develop ultralight airplane

UL - 39 Albi is an ultralight jet with its propeller placed inside of the airplane, so that radars are unable to detect the thermal radiation.
